Electrical Technical Authority Greatham, Hartlepool | Site Engineering Wolviston Management Services are recruiting on behalf of Tioxide Materials Ltd for an experienced Electrical Technical Authority to join the Site Engineering function at their manufacturing facility in Greatham, Hartlepool. This is a senior technical position providing site-wide electrical engineering leadership, governance and assurance across Tioxide's electrical assets and infrastructure. Acting as the recognised site Electrical Technical Authority, you will define engineering standards, maintain electrical asset integrity, provide technical approval for significant engineering decisions and ensure electrical risks are effectively managed throughout the asset lifecycle. The role covers HV and LV distribution, transformers, switchgear, motor control centres, drives, UPS systems, protection systems, hazardous area compliance, electrical safety and long-term asset lifecycle management.
